Wildfire — Western Siskiyou County, California

2025-08-26 to 2025-08-31 · Western Siskiyou County, California

Event narrative

The Log Wildfire was discovered on August 26th. The fire started 18 miles west of Etna in Siskiyou County, California. The fire was caused by lightning. As of 530 AM PST on August 31st, it had burned 140 acres, was 0% contained, no structures had been destroyed, and it had cost $ 0.5M.
